Transaction fdd263a93c8f11ebea9a52ab40d305459ac63ab734461e0c833a46df27405eea
1 Input
1 Output
-
fdd263a93c8f11ebea9a52ab40d305459ac63ab734461e0c833a46df27405eea:0
- value
- 152440
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14b7d4cd684a3daa550bff3dbae37418e6c8d6a7 OP_EQUAL
- address
- 33aZfCZevg1hsEzC5r8YVJKDAr4wCXsaaK